I’m Nikki.
This month, I joined the MDS Canada team as communications coordinator. I entered this role following seven years with Mennonite Central Committee (MCC) Manitoba, where my work has spanned administration, donor stewardship, engagement and a cultivated focus on communications.
I see a lot of parallels between MDS and MCC, including a missional focus on disaster response, a strong tradition of volunteerism, faith through action, and prioritizing the needs and empowerment of vulnerable people. I am thrilled to become a part of MDS’ good work.
Receiving someone’s story is a gift. That is the most beautiful lesson I learned in communications work with MCC. I was continually inspired by the dedication and purpose that propels volunteers, and by the resilience and resourcefulness of the participants in MCC’s work. I know that I will be gifted with stories like these in MDS, too.
Over the coming months, I look forward to opportunities to visit project sites, connecting with volunteers and disaster survivors, and learning about MDS more deeply.
